COURSE DESCRIPTION

This course is designed to provide students with an understanding of the complexities of global trade, its impact on logistics, and key areas of concern for international logistics managers. Key topics are investigated such as: Incoterms, global trade compliance, harmonized tariff schedules, US import and export regulations, US Free Trade Agreements, and supply chain security.
